The site uses Astro (https://astro.build/) and the code blocks are generated using Shiki (https://shiki.style/). As Shiki generates the HTML and CSS at build-time instead of requiring runtime JS like alternatives like Prism (https://prismjs.com/#basic-usage), it's actually quite performant.
